Vendor profile

eScreen
Part of Abbott
eScreen provides rapid drug testing technology, electronic chain-of-custody, and results management through a national clinic network, and is part of Abbott. It centers on the testing workflow rather than broader occupational health management.

Strengths
- ✓Paperless chain-of-custody and rapid results
- ✓Large national collection network
- ✓Established testing technology
Things to confirm
- !Drug-testing focused, not full OH software
- !No injury case or medical surveillance system
- !Typically integrates with an OH or HR platform
